Transaction 4622edd5676906ef9209a2102ed284a79567694583705f9e1856f5a5b992e785

6 Input
2 Outputs
  • 4622edd5676906ef9209a2102ed284a79567694583705f9e1856f5a5b992e785:0
  • value  25659051
    address  16Rw2a8hSrv7Q4AXSF6AtGix9xQ9TyWqEc
  • 4622edd5676906ef9209a2102ed284a79567694583705f9e1856f5a5b992e785:1
  • value  1277615
    address  bc1q3ynzvgywskdmwvu47tn74cr2xj0txmuq59r3dt